Bill History

  1. 2026-03-23 Sen.

    Failed to adopt pursuant to Senate Joint Resolution 1

  2. 2025-12-12 Sen.

    Introduced by Senators Jacque and Nass ; cosponsored by Representatives Brill , O'Connor , Behnke , Wichgers , Krug , Ortiz-Velez , Maxey , Gundrum , Tusler , Allen , Tranel , Goodwin , Armstrong , Kaufert , Kreibich , Donovan , Murphy , Goeben and Knodl

  3. 2025-12-12 Sen.

    Read and referred to Committee on Senate Organization

  4. 2025-12-12 Sen.

    Available for scheduling
